2012-04-12 47 views
-1

我通過Java Webstart(使用Oracle JDK/JRE 1.7 + Java FX 2)部署應用程序。
它工作正常,對於大多數用戶來說,有時(並不總是)啓動應用程序時得到這個錯誤他們卻一個:無法創建JVM:JVM日誌位置

Error: Could not create the Java Virtual Machine. 
Error: A fatal exception has occured. Program will exit. 

有沒有一種方法,以獲取有關問題原因(如日誌的詳細信息)?
任何想法可能是什麼問題?

+1

我認爲這是硬件/ RAM問題一般(特別是因爲它有時會發生)。做一些谷歌搜索,你會發現有幾個人經歷了這一點。但是,在用戶的機器上獲得更多信息將是一件好事。 – 2012-04-12 15:14:50

+0

我做過谷歌它,但注意到大多數遇到內存問題的人都有一個特定的錯誤消息,例如「無法爲對象堆預留足夠的空間」。該PC是一個Windows 7x64,具有8個RAM的內存,並且不能在密集的條件下使用。你知道我在啓動應用程序之前是否可以專門檢查內存的數量是否足夠(我的意思是手動)? – assylias 2012-04-12 15:17:14

+1

好吧,我擡頭一看:錯誤:致命的錯覺......以及我發現內存錯誤的地方(特別是使用Java的其他東西)。編輯run.bat/dat.bat被建議作爲可能的解決方案?不幸的是,由於錯誤的模糊性,很難提出可靠的解決方案,但這裏是我發現的:[link1](http://groups.google.com/group/akka-user/browse_thread/ thread/bb0e26255984fc11?pli = 1)[link2](http://forums.bukkit.org/threads/java-problem.68817/)[link3](http://nest.array.ca/web/nest/forum/-/message_boards/message/234665) – 2012-04-12 15:52:20

回答

1

複製從評論: - 我認爲這是一個硬件/ RAM問題一般(特別是因爲它有時會發生)。做一些谷歌搜索,你會發現有幾個人經歷了這一點。但是,在用戶的機器上獲得更多信息將是一件好事。 - 我擡頭看看錯誤:致命的錯覺......以及我發現內存錯誤的地方(特別是使用Java的其他東西)。編輯run.bat/dat.bat被建議作爲可能的解決方案?不幸的是,由於錯誤的模糊的煩躁,它非常難以提出一個可靠的解決方案,但這裏是我發現了什麼呢: link1link2link3

1

我幾乎同樣的問題(我有這個錯誤,每次),並固定在的eclipse.ini

--launcher.XXMaxPermSize 
256m 

改變到

--launcher.XXMaxPermSize 
900m 

900是 xmx低於